Tommy Bolin (1951–1976) was an American guitarist noted for work spanning rock, blues and fusion; he played with acts including the James Gang and Deep Purple and contributed to Billy Cobham's Spectrum.

Contributed guitar to Billy Cobham's album Spectrum; played with the James Gang and Deep Purple; died in 1976 (drug-related).

The available DeBaser review celebrates Live At Ebbets Field '74 as a document of a single, magical jam night showcasing Tommy Bolin's range across rock, blues, funk and fusion. The reviewer highlights improvisation, slide work, tape-echo effects and a memorable take on "Stratus." The overall verdict is highly positive.
